Output a8eab1ca92f198865156622674b585a4a41674e9e408a32ee6af999161f6f899:1

value
18529814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33495fe783b49c233719b91086917992b2e2c1e8 OP_EQUAL
address
MCaLbNXWwcbdmr2QBx5dEhMC4DcJ3BctMG
transaction
a8eab1ca92f198865156622674b585a4a41674e9e408a32ee6af999161f6f899
spent
true